I run a Prankster set with Will-o-Wisp, Foul Play, Recover, and Taunt. You can beat any physical attacker one on one by burning it then hitting it with its own Attack stat; as all your moves other than Foul Play have priority, it's difficult to outplay and KO. I've had many opponents not catch on and keep sending physical attackers against it. Priority Confuse Ray really annoys people too, if you want to run that instead.

Its Ghost typing makes it a hilarious switch-in to High Jump Kick Blaziken, too. With prediction, you can alternate between Sableye and a Flash Fire user to beat Blaziken without taking damage.

So where exactly do you find out your Pokemon's IVs in-game? Within Super Training?

You can find any 31s by speaking to the 'Judge' in Kiloude City Pokémon Center - he'll say the stat "can't be beat" if it's 31. The characteristic in the Summary screen also tells you the stat your best IV is in (and its value mod 5).

First time breeder here, actually the last poke game I played was Yellow :lol

What you want to do is to first plan what you want to get, including nature and iv's. Generally you dont need the 6 perfect IV's as is really unlikely you will make a pokemon use both Special and Physical attacks, so aiming for 4 or 5 perfect IV should be fine. Depends on your strat mostly, I guess stallers wont need either special or physical attack.

Next, you really need to get to the post game and get a friend safary with either the pokemon you want or ditto. In the safari pokemons always have 2 perfect IV's so you can pass those down.

Got that? Now, you will need to get a pokemon with syncronize and the desired nature, I got a bunch of raltz with the natures I found useful and keep track of them on a excel sheet. Why we need that? because a pokemon with syncronize that starts a battle will have a 50% chance of encounter a wild pokemon of the same nature. Also you need a pokemon with flame body, like the small fire bird from the early game (he needs to evolve iirc).

I am aiming for a Modest (increases sp attack but decreases attack) Bulbasaur with as many perfect IV as possible and it must include Sp. Attack, but not Attack as I wont use that one. On top of that, I want the hidden ability.

Now, with the raltz leading the party and equiped with the smoke ball (so he can escape any battle with other mons) I ran to get a couple of ivysaurs from the safary. Got like 5-6 of them, both sex and checked the IV's with the IV checker on the same city. Selected a pair with different IV's and just put the aside.

The next step is to get em ready for the day care. You want to equip them with some hold items, the desnty knot and the everstone.
The destiny knot will make sure the mons will inherit 5 IV's at random from the parents. And the everstone will make them inherit the nature of the holder.
Put them on the day care and get eggs.

Get the eggs and put the mon with flame body in your party, eggs will hatch in half the time.

Everytime you get a new batch of mons, go and check the IV's. If you get one with the desired skill, and more than 2 perfect IV's, use it to replace the one parent on the day care so the eggs have better chances to inherit good IV's. Repeat until you start getting 4 IV's mons.

In my case, because I'm an idiot, I got my 4 perfect IV pokemon with HP, Defense, Sp Defense and Speed. But no SP attack, and that was my target! So what I'm doing now is breeding a 4 perfect IV female bulbasaur with Sp Attack, and when I get one, I'll put it together with the other one and try to aim for 5 perfect IV.

Edit: You dont have to do the same proces for each one. I will use a almost perfect male bulbasaur to be the father of my next project (asuming is in the same egg group, like a charmander), so next time it should be faster.
